Introduction and Main application of tungsten carbide rod

Tungsten Carbide is a kind of Hard Metal due to it’s very high hardness compare to other metals. TypicallyTungsten Carbide can have a hardness value of 1600 HV, is 10 times of mild steel.

Tungsten Carbides is mainly used for making drills, endmills, reamers, etc. It have a wide range of application in many industry sectors such as metal machining, wear parts for mining and oil industries, metal forming tools, cutting tips for saw blades and have now expanded to include consumer items such as watch cases and wedding rings,  plus the ball that is in many ball point pens.

Some grade information for Reference

GradeDensity g/cm3Hardness HRA(hv)T.R.S (M Pa)Grain Size(μm)
YL10.214.592.538000.6-0.8
YG614.989.521500.8-1.2
YG814.68923200.8-1.2
YG1114.487.522600.8-1.2
YG1514.186.524000.8-1.2
YS2T14.4592.528000.6-0.8
YNi814.688.517100.8-1.2

Manufacturing process of tugnsten carbide rod

Tungsten Carbide Hard Metals are primarily produced using a Powder Metallurgy process, whereby the powdered forms of tungsten carbide and cobalt are mixed using ball mills, a binder material is added to hold the powders together during the next stage of the process which is compaction or pressing.

During the compaction processes, hydraulic presses or isostatic presses are used to compact the powders into a shape which approximates the design of the finished product.

Whilst in this condition, the powder compact can be easily machined using conventional metal working tools. This process is often referred to as “Green Machining”. Care has to be taken with the removal of the fine powder particles as they can pose a health hazard so effective extraction methods are required.

Following “Green Machining” the powder compact is then ready to be Sintered. Typically this is done in a vacuum furnace at temperatures between 1300 and 1600°C.

The sintering process causes the tungsten carbide and cobalt matrix to fuse together to produce a dense “Hard Metal”.

After sintering the material is so hard that it can only be machined by diamond grinding, a specialised form of micro machining that is relatively expensive as it is not possible to remove large amounts of materials by this process.
